SKILLTREES

Skill trees make the game go where you want it to, depending on how you play of course. There is a rusty sword that can be brought back to its former glory. Once it becomes a thunder sword, Barbarians, Heroes and Greys can use it. Why I mention it is because it can use a thunder slash, once you use thunder slash 50 times, you gain a thunder spell. Use the thunder spell 50 times, you earn Thunder All and after another level up or so times it becomes Thunder II.

The Scan skill gets better with time when you use it too. So does heal. Healing branches out into giving the user heal, Heal II, Heal All, Weapon Bless, Cure and so on. The more you use a spell, the more you learn. To learn Heal III, you will have needed to use Heal II a lot of times.

Your character becomes your own. There are heal orbs, staffs and wands that will let you temporarily use the spell until it becomes YOURS. So the Healer, Hero, and Grey can become characters that specialize in healing.

In time, you can turn your average Magician into a Fire Mage, Ice Mage, Dark Mage and so on. A Grey can become a dark magic using healer, or a holy mage with a side of dark magic. You can make a thunder Barbarian or a healing Hero. Why stop there? If you want your Magician to know every elemental magic in the game you can do it. Start with a fire wand, learn the fire spells, go to the terra wand and go through the terra spells.

BECOME VAMPIRES
There are cursed items in the game, equip them and they are stuck on you until you uncurse them. There are certain equipment that give you vampire abilities (or other abilities). With the skill tree for vampires, you get added strength, power, speed, and intelligence. You also gain the vampirism skill. Use it 20 times and you gain the chill ability (ice) and follow that skill tree. Use Vampirism 50 times and you get the Evil skill (dark magic) and follow that skill tree. You will also get status magic like sleep, paralysis and so on.

This would of course lead to an uber character if there was not a catch. You need to keep your vampire alive. You are weak to holy magic, there is a good deal of slip damage and the vampire cannot have any status ailments. No bonuses like ATK up.

There are great bennefits to having a vampire character, but only if you can keep them alive. The churches can make vampirism cures, but it is never easy or cheap. Once the character is cured of vampirism, the skills are kept, except for the vampirism skill that lets you drink blood.

Imagine a healing, thunder crashing Vampire Hero... Or a holy healer that can cure, suck blood, chill and use dark magic. I am having fun with this just playing it!

There is a four step process to forging equipment:

 - get a pick axe
 - mine for ore
 - process the ore
 - forge the equipment

So far there are three minerals to mine for. Copper, iron, and steel. Deposites are everywhere, and they replenish themselves after a good amount of time. You need a different level of pick axe to mine for minerals. A copper pick axe can mine for copper, but not iron or steel. A steel pick axe can mine for steel, copper and iron ore.

HOW IS IT FUN?

It becomes a mini game, because you do not just get ore. You find items like potions and pork chops. Yes pork chops, you find them in the wall like Castlevania.

WHAT IS THE CHALLENGE?

Because all enemies are lively in the game and can chase you, the party will need to mine, and get out of there quickly so you cannot wait around for the deposite to replenish. There is also a risk of breaking the pick axe you are using, but it is only a 1 in 50 chance.

There is another catch too. Mining is work! Anyone ever try to mine something? Its taxing on your body, especially before drills! Depending on what you are mining for, your party will take damage. Such as steel ore, your party will take 20 HP and MP damage. But at that point your party will have 400 HP.

2 ORES ROW A BOAT!

They do, but that's oars! Once you have all the ore you can collect, take it to a forge and they can make 2 ores into 1 processed mineral.

FORGING

Once you have processed minerals at the forge, you can have the forge make equipment. All the standard equipment that the shops sell, but later on in the third town of Thedona, they can make you better equipment than the shops. The forges can even restore ugly weapons to their former glory, making them more powerful and useful! They can even combine weapons to make a better new weapon, like combining the chain whip and a mace will make the morning star!

MINING IS STILL NO FUN FOR ME...

For those that do not want to go mining, you can buy processed minerals, but at a higher price of course! Forging your equipment is slightly cheaper depending on what the merchant has it priced at.

BARGAIN HUNTERS

I may have mentioned this, but most every shop has their own prices. The elves have a high markup, meaning their prices are more expensive. Thedona's prices are very expensive for weapons, armor and magic that Aereachi sells. Kind of like they want you to go back and get it elsewhere.

Each shop has its own bargain bin, usually potions or inferior equipment that is sold for cheaper than it would normally be. Like the elves sell copper equipment for cheaper than they do in Eraki Village.
